Translation of stain in Setswana



nounPlural stains

  • 1

    • a dirty mark on something
  • 2

    tirô e e maswê e mongwe a e dirileng
    • a blemish on somebody's character or past record
  • 3

    seeledi se se dirang sebala
    • a liquid used for staining things

verbstains, staining, stained

  • 1

    dira sebala
    • make a stain on something
  • 2

    taka ka seeledi
    • colour with a liquid that sinks into the surface